Students work in pairs, each with a different set of angles. Students find the values of the six trigonometric functions for special angles. They check their answers with their partner's answers. They must then determine why some answers are the same, and why some answers are different. They must write a summary of their conclusions. I use this as a review before giving a quiz on CA Standard for Trigonometry 9.0.
